Technical data

This 3.4 PDK (350 hp) engine was fitted in the 991 Carrera cabriolet 2-doors, which was produced by Porsche from 2011 to 2015. Power & fuel consumption

City fuel consumption per 100 km11.4litre
Highway fuel consumption per 100 km6.7litre
Mixed fuel consumption per 100 km8.4litre
Fuel tank capacity64litre
Cruising rangefrom 560 to 960km
Fuel98 RON
Emission standardEURO V
Top speed284km/h
Acceleration (0–100 km/h)4.8second

Engine

Displacement3436cm3
Engine power350bhp
RPM at max powerto 7 400RPM
Maximum torque390Nm
RPM at max torque5600RPM
Engine typeGasoline
Cylinder layoutOpposed
Injection typeDirect injection
Number of cylinders6
Valves per cylinder4

Gearbox & drivetrain

GearboxElectronic
Number of gears7
Drive wheelsRear-wheel drive
Turning circle11.1m

Body

Seats2
Length4491mm
Width1808mm
Height1299mm
Wheelbase2450mm
Front track1532mm
Rear track1518mm
Ground clearance122mm
Kerb weight1470kg
Gross weight1870kg
Min. boot capacity135litre
Max. boot capacity135litre
Body typeCabriolet

Suspension & brakes

Front suspensionIndependent, MacPherson Struts, Stabilizer bar
Rear suspensionIndependent, Multi wishbone, Stabilizer bar
Front brakesVentilated disc
Rear brakesVentilated disc
